Unidad 2. Notacion Para El Modelado de Procesos de Negocio BPMN

Click here to load reader

  • date post

    22-Oct-2015
  • Category

    Documents

  • view

    62
  • download

    6

Embed Size (px)

Transcript of Unidad 2. Notacion Para El Modelado de Procesos de Negocio BPMN

  • Modelado de negocios Programa desarrollado

    Educacin Superior Abierta y a Distancia Ciencias Exactas, Ingeniera y Tecnologa 1

    Ingeniera en Desarrollo de Software

    CUATRIMESTRE: 04

    Programa de la asignatura:

    Modelado de negocios

    Unidad 2. Notacin para el Modelado de Procesos de

    Negocio (BPMN)

    Clave: 160920416 / 150920416

  • Modelado de negocios Programa desarrollado

    Educacin Superior Abierta y a Distancia Ciencias Exactas, Ingeniera y Tecnologa 2

    ndice

    Unidad 2. Notacin para el Modelado de Procesos de Negocio (BPMN) ............................... 3

    Presentacin de la unidad ........................................................................................................... 3

    Propsitos ...................................................................................................................................... 4

    Competencia especfica .............................................................................................................. 4

    Consideraciones especficas de la unidad ............................................................................... 4

    2.1. Definicin y Objetivos ........................................................................................................... 4

    2.1.1. Beneficios de BPMN ......................................................................................................... 5

    2.1.2. Objetivos al crear BPMN .................................................................................................. 7

    Actividad 1. Generalidades del BPMN ...................................................................................... 7

    Actividad 2. Uso del BPMN ......................................................................................................... 8

    2.2. Artefactos ............................................................................................................................... 8

    2.2.1. Tipos de elementos de BPMN ....................................................................................... 11

    2.2.2. Asociaciones de los elementos BPMN ........................................................................ 13

    Actividad 3. Ejemplo visual de un modelo basado en BPMN .............................................. 18

    Autoevaluacin ........................................................................................................................... 18

    Evidencia de aprendizaje. Manual del uso del BPMN y sus componentes ...................... 18

    Cierre de la unidad ..................................................................................................................... 19

    Para saber ms ........................................................................................................................... 20

    Fuentes de consulta ................................................................................................................... 20

  • Modelado de negocios Programa desarrollado

    Educacin Superior Abierta y a Distancia Ciencias Exactas, Ingeniera y Tecnologa 3

    Unidad 2. Notacin para el Modelado de Procesos de Negocio (BPMN)

    Presentacin de la unidad

    En la unidad anterior viste temas introductorios al modelado de negocios, cuyos temas

    fungieron como iniciacin para comprender el uso y aplicacin del modelado. En la

    presente unidad, aprenders el concepto del BPMN y su utilizacin para crear modelos

    completos y complejos; posteriormente se ligar con la siguiente unidad, donde se tratar

    la utilizacin conjunta del Lenguaje Unificado de Modelado (UML, por sus siglas en ingls:

    Unified Modeling Language) y la Notacin para el Modelado de Procesos de Negocio

    (BPMN, por sus siglas en ingls: Business Process Modeling Notation).

    La Notacin para el Modelado de Procesos de Negocio (BPMN) implica, dentro de su

    propia definicin, que deben plasmarse representaciones escritas y de preferencia

    grficas de lo que est sucediendo al interior de cualquier organizacin. Cada

    organizacin persigue diferentes fines al intentar entender qu es lo que pasa en su

    quehacer diario, desde la mejora interna, hasta poder sobresalir de la competencia; para

    ello sigue sus propios pasos en algunas ocasiones, ms cortos y con resultados

    inmediatos- con el fin de lograr el objetivo que persiguen.

    Las organizaciones se hacen preguntas como: qu hacer para producir ms a un menor

    costo?, de qu manera se puede hacer que el producto llegue al cliente mucho ms

    rpido que la competencia con un nivel de calidad superior? El BPMN ayuda a resolver

    estas dudas, como lo vemos a continuacin.

    El BPMN puede hacerse desde distintas perspectivas integrales que nos llevan a un

    mismo fin, como son:

    Mapas de procesos: Diagramas de flujo de las actividades sin ms detalle que

    las propias actividades en s.

    Descripcin de procesos: Proporcionan ms informacin, por ejemplo los

    involucrados, datos, entre otros.

    Modelos de procesos: Es la conjuncin de los dos anteriores, dando tanta

    informacin y de manera necesaria para poder simular la ejecucin del modelo

    que intenta describir.

    El BPMN se basa en un conjunto estndar de elementos grficos para hacer la

    descripcin de los procesos y saber cul es la secuencia lgica para poder llevarlos desde

    el comienzo hasta el fin, los Objetos de Flujo:

    Actividades

    Eventos

    Puertas de enlace

    Flujos de secuencia

  • Modelado de negocios Programa desarrollado

    Educacin Superior Abierta y a Distancia Ciencias Exactas, Ingeniera y Tecnologa 4

    Propsitos

    En esta unidad logrars:

    Definir el BPMN y sus objetivos.

    Distinguir los artefactos que utiliza el BPMN.

    Distinguir la asociacin de elementos de BPMN.

    Competencia especfica

    Distinguir la notacin para el modelado de procesos del negocio logrando usar los

    elementos que componen esta notacin, de manera tal que con prctica se logre plasmar

    claramente el modelo del negocio.

    Consideraciones especficas de la unidad

    Es muy importante que realices todas las actividades planteadas para que logres

    comprender los temas que se abordarn a lo largo de la unidad; del mismo modo, realiza

    todos los ejemplos de diagramas para que te familiarices con los componentes grficos,

    para esto puedes utilizar el programa Visio de Microsoft.

    2.1. Definicin y Objetivos

    Se puede definir a la Notacin para el Modelado de Procesos de Negocio (BPMN, por sus

    siglas en ingls: Business Process Modeling Notation) como la captura de una serie

    ordenada de actividades e informacin de apoyo que refuerzan a stas. Modelar un

    Proceso de Negocio incluye la representacin de cmo una empresa realiza los pasos

    necesarios para lograr sus objetivos centrales y, aunque los objetivos son la parte

    primordial de todo el modelado, no se capturan dentro del modelo, se sobreentiende que

    se modelan los pasos para poder llegar a ellos. Con BPMN slo los procesos son

    modelados.

    Los objetivos principales que persigue BPMN son:

    1. Tener una representacin grfica del Lenguaje de Modelado de Procesos de Negocio

    (BPML, por sus siglas en ingls: Business Process Modeling Language), pues es

    primordial tener una notacin orientada hacia las necesidades del usuario, es decir,

    una traduccin de la notacin orientada al negocio al lenguaje tcnico en ejecucin

    (White, 2009).

  • Modelado de negocios Programa desarrollado

    Educacin Superior Abierta y a Distancia Ciencias Exactas, Ingeniera y Tecnologa 5

    2. Unificar la amplia gama de notaciones de modelado, pues en el mercado se maneja

    una enorme variedad de stas y son utilizadas en forma arbitraria segn el gusto y

    necesidad de quien las usa.

    3. Consolidar los principios subyacentes del modelado de procesos, se pretende una

    notacin comn, en cuanto a la representacin.

    4. Llevar el ejercicio acadmico a la practicidad de las empresas, tanto para los

    proveedores de herramientas de modelado como para los consumidores de stas.

    5. Hacer el aprendizaje transferible al estandarizar la manera de representar los modelos

    de negocio y las herramientas necesarias para hacerlo.

    6. Proporcionar un modelo ejecutable entre la representacin grfica (BPML y el

    lenguaje de representacin formal (BPML, llamado luego BPEL - Business

    Process Execution Language, WS-BPEL, en castellano, Lenguaje de Ejecucin de

    Procesos de Negocio con Servicios Web-). Por lo tanto, proporciona un mapeo

    vlido entre los diagramas y el lenguaje formal, de manera que se pueda

    automatizar la ejecucin del modelo resultante.

    2.1.1. Beneficios de BPMN

    Cuando se pretende dar a entender una idea, hay muchas formas de hacerlo. Por ejemplo

    para describir lo que es la letra A, se puede hacer mediante descripciones muy

    detalladas de manera verbal, pidindole que: imagine un tringulo pero con la parte de

    abajo a la mitad, o como la interseccin de dos lneas en un ngulo de 45 y ambas

    cortadas al centro por otra lnea paralela al ngulo mencionado en una distancia igual al

    50% de su longitud, entre muchas otras explicaciones producto de la prodigiosa

    imaginacin del descriptor; pero en realidad el receptor no tendr el concepto completo

    (definicin adems de representacin) si no se le da a conocer de manera grfica c